Janette Elaine Hurd Wipf, 87, slipped into the arms of her Savior on November 3, 2015. She was born July 25, 1928, in Sioux Falls, South Dakota, the fourth child and eldest daughter of Guy Ray Hurd and Zola Edith Kosier. On October 23, 1948, she married Rev. Melvin James Wipf in Emery, South Dakota. Together they had three daughters and two sons. They lived in Sioux Falls, St. Paul, Sarles, Bridgewater, Cavalier and Fargo.

Janette is preceded in death by her parents, her husband, a daughter, Sally Joan, and her brother Bob. She leaves to cherish her memory Bob's wife Janet and her siblings Donald (Alice), Joan Holler and Carol (Jack) Scott, and her children Jacque (David) Olson, Colorado Springs, Colorado; Judy (Leo) Lage, Cavalier, North Dakota; Fr. Terry Wipf, Bismarck, North Dakota; and Randal (Kathy) Wipf, Jupiter Farms, Florida; as well as nine grandchildren, three grandchildren-in-law, and six great-grandchildren.

She was a CNA for Lutheran Hospitals and Homes, and worked for several years at Rosewood on Broadway, where she lived for the last seven and a half years. An accomplished vocalist, Janette often sang for weddings, and was active in the Fargo Chapter of Sweet Adelines International (now A Cappella Express). She is also an avid supporter of NDSU Bison football and basketball and F-M RedHawks baseball.
